数据结构中动态分配空间

news/2024/7/4 13:10:32

1:就链式而言(我个人比较喜欢链式因为链式缺少空间可以以加结点的形式来进行增加比较方便)


#include <iostream>
#include <stdlib.h>
using namespace  std;
void dongtaifenpei(){
	int *p;
	p=new int;(new一个新的类型为可以为结构体类型比较常见)
			//申请了一个int类型的空间用new方法这时候p指向的地
			//址为新申请的空间的地址

}
#include <malloc.h>
int len;//数组长度
int *p;
p=(int *)malloc(sizeof(int)*len);
附加长度用realloc
p=(int*)realloc(p,sizeof(int)*len*2);//扩充2倍


http://www.niftyadmin.cn/n/4788546.html

相关文章

5个重要的人工智能预测(2019年)每个人都应该阅读

人工智能 - 特别是机器学习和深度学习 - 在2018年无处不在&#xff0c;并且预计未来12个月的炒作将不会消失。 当然&#xff0c;炒作最终会消亡&#xff0c;人工智能将成为我们生活中的另一个连贯的线索&#xff0c;就像互联网&#xff0c;电力和燃烧在过去几天一样。 但至少…

VMware 菜鸟教程

VMware下载与安装 一、 虚拟机的下载 进入VMware官网&#xff08;https://www.vmware.com/cn.html&#xff09;&#xff0c;可能会有一点慢&#xff0c;耐心等待。 点击下载&#xff0c;进入到如下页面 点击下载产品 可以看到这里有两个版本&#xff0c;windows和Linux版本&…

VMware tools详细教程 解决安装失败等问题

1、打开虚拟机VMware Workstation&#xff0c;启动Ubuntu系统&#xff0c;菜单栏 - 虚拟机 - 安装VMware Tools&#xff0c;不启动Ubuntu系统是无法点击“安装VMware Tools”选项的&#xff0c;如下图&#xff1a; 必须在虚拟机内部进行安装&#xff01;&#xff01;&#xff0…

人工智能创造了一个假世界 - 这对人类意味着什么?

“眼见为实”或是吗&#xff1f;曾经有一段时间我们可以确信我们在照片和视频中看到的内容是真实的。即使Photoshopping图像变得流行&#xff0c;我们仍然知道图像是作为原始图像开始的。现在&#xff0c;随着人工智能的进步&#xff0c;世界变得越来越虚化&#xff0c;你不能确…

使用人工智能自定义无偏见的内容

&#xff08;想自学习编程的小伙伴请搜索圈T社区&#xff0c;更多行业相关资讯更有行业相关免费视频教程。完全免费哦!&#xff09; 使用人工智能&#xff08;AI&#xff09;定制内容正在改变今天内容消费和货币化的方式。从媒体到制造&#xff0c;人工智能在公司如何创建更加…

指导人工智能期望的四条规则

对于任何技术来说&#xff0c;世界是否太混乱了&#xff1f;技术是否揭示出事物比最初想象的更加混乱和无法控制&#xff1f;人工智能&#xff0c;机器学习和相关技术可能正在强调阿尔伯特爱因斯坦几十年前所认识到的&#xff1a;“我学的越多&#xff0c;我就越意识到我不知道…

我才你需要这个调试工具,永远不要再使用print进行调试

一般情况下&#xff0c;在编写 Python 代码时&#xff0c;如果想弄清楚为什么 Python 代码没有按照预期执行的原因&#xff0c;比如你想知道哪些是正在运行&#xff0c;哪些没有运行&#xff0c;以及局部变量的值是什么…通常我们会使用包含断点和观察模式等功能成熟的调试器&a…

AI将如何永远改变B2B营销的方式

早在2006年&#xff0c;Phil Fernandez&#xff0c;Jon Miller和David Morandi创立了 Marketo。当时&#xff0c;他们只有PowerPoint。但话说回来&#xff0c;他们还有一个令人信服的愿景&#xff0c;即创建一个称为营销自动化的新类别。 &#xff08;想自学习编程的小伙伴请搜…